About the Role:

Identify the dental hygiene treatment plan according to individual patients needs, ensuring that patient oral health is the focus.


Responsibilities:

The ideal candidate will ensure the highest standards of patient care that will ensure the best outcome for the patients.

  • Using best practices for infection control including processing instruments and treatment rooms;
  • Performing Medical health history screening and updates;
  • Conducting baseline and routine assessments (including full mouth charting, probing, oral cancer screening);
  • Taking radiographs and impressions (as prescribed by the Dentist), intra oral photos;
  • Identifying conditions and oral disease such as: gingivitis, caries or periodontitis;
  • Dental Hygiene treatment planning, including patient specific preventive dental care (scaling, prophy, fluoride etc. as required);
  • Educating patients by providing oral hygiene instruction, plaque control instructions and postoperative instructions as required;
  • Maintaining accurate documentation/charting;
  • Identifying gaps in clinical schedule and assist with scheduling, such as: booking preventive recall appointments, following up with outstanding treatment plans;
  • Collaborating with colleagues during down-time in schedule (Dental Hygienists, Dental Assistants Dentists and Administration); and
  • Attending continuing education events from time to time.


Requirements:

  • Diploma or Degree in Dental Hygiene
  • Registered Dental Hygienist in good standing with the CDHO
  • 2 years or more experience as a Dental Hygienist
  • Experience ensuring infection control
  • Experience in making assessments of oral health, hard tissue, periodontal conditions, oral hygiene care.
  • Experience in different types of intraoral radiographs and their interpretation.
  • Experience in gather client’s health history information, ability to assess risks associated with treatment plan
  • Trained in Covid-19 IPAC regulations in client care.
  • Experience with Dental software such as SAPPHIRE, Tracker and Abeldent.
  • Outstanding communication skills and attention to detail
  • A friendly personality who works collaboratively with a team
